Repairs to window locks made of UPVC

uPVC windows are a popular option for new homes and renovations. These windows offer many benefits, such as durability as well as ease of maintenance and energy efficiency. These windows are BPAand phthalate-free, making them safe for children. They are also rust-proof, and don't require painting or varnishing to keep looking at their best. They are also resistant to be warped, rot, or leak, and are simple to clean. Despite their strength and ease in maintenance, uPVC can sometimes develop problems that require attention from a professional. These problems may include a draughty window or a broken handle or a faulty lock.

Most of the time, uPVC door and window locks become damaged over time because of wear and tear or accidental damage. This makes them less secure and more susceptible to break-ins. It is therefore essential to fix the component as soon as you can. It is possible to do this by contacting a local double glazing specialist. This type of specialist is certified to carry out a variety of repairs and upgrades on uPVC doors and windows. They also can recommend other security products, such as letterbox guards and door viewers.

If your uPVC windows won't close properly, it could be due to a gap between the frame and the sash. This problem can cause draughts, but it can also cause dampness and water damage. You can check by putting an item of paper between the frame and the sash, to see whether the sash is closed.

To fix the issue, you'll need to take off the seals around the frame and the sash. You will then need to remove the locking mechanism from its place inside the frame. To access the gearbox you will require a flat screwdriver or torch. After you have removed the gearbox, you will need to replace with a new one that is the same size and type.

You can also engage an expert local to help you fix the uPVC window lock. They'll have the tools they need to complete the task. They are also familiar with the various types of uPVC windows and will be able to recognize yours on the phone. They will be able to identify your issue quickly and provide you with an estimate for repair work.

Repair UPVC window frames

It is crucial to fix any holes, cracks or broken seals on your uPVC Windows as quickly as you can. These issues can cause the glass to become cloudy, and they may also cause water leaks. Furthermore, the damage to the frames can reduce the insulation value of your home and cause increased energy costs. Luckily, most of these problems can be repaired with some basic DIY repairs or hiring an experienced professional.

UPVC window repair is more economical than replacing the entire window, however there are situations where it is better to replace the whole unit. This is particularly true when the frame is damaged beyond repair. There are many aspects that affect the total cost of UPVC window replacement, such as the type of material used and the amount of work involved. A complete replacement may cost between $100 and $1000 for a window. The price will differ according to the severity of damage and whether or the need for the window needs to be replaced.

It is crucial to clean UPVC windows on a regular basis to avoid the accumulation of dirt and moisture. It will save you money on repairs in the future. Generally speaking, you should do this at least two times per year. You could also use WD-40 for lubricating the moving parts of your UPVC windows. It's best to use a soft brush to get rid of any cobwebs or dust from the frame prior cleaning it. You can also sand any scuff marks on frames to make them look new.

Window frames made of wood are prone to rot and deterioration over time. They can also split or crack because of the sun's heat. Wooden frames require more frequent repairs than UPVC and fiberglass models. These issues can be fixed with simple fixes that are cheaper than replacements.

UPVC frames are a fantastic option for homeowners as they provide a number of advantages over wood frames. UPVC is strong, simple to maintain, and visually appealing. It's also greener than traditional wood and helps keep energy bills down. To avoid the need for expensive UPVC repair it is possible to fix minor issues with the beading as well as the sill. Furthermore, you can make the frames more attractive by refinishing them with paint or stain.
